Lesson: Double Pentatonic Scale
Technique: Electric Guitar Pentatonic Scale
One great method to expand your pentatonic horizons is to adopt what Elixir® Strings artist Quentin Angus describes as the “double pentatonic” scale. As he demonstrates, the double involves taking a minor pentatonic shape and combining with the “next door” major pentatonic – which gives a cool repeating note on adjacent strings. That gives a distinctive, unusual note pattern that you can incorporate in solos and riff ideas, so work on the stretches that you’ll need to reach the notes and have fun working on some new vibes!
